CCCam is a protocol used to share pay-TV subscription cards over a network. It is commonly used with certain satellite receivers (e.g., Dreambox, Vu+, Openbox) to decode encrypted channels without a direct subscription to each individual receiver.
If you ever find a working 5-day line, it is not being "generated" by software on your PC. Instead, the generator is likely downloading a pre-made, time-limited line from a public CCCam sharing forum. The 5-day limit is manually set by the server administrator, not magically generated. CCCam is a protocol used to share pay-TV subscription cards over a network (usually the internet). It allows multiple users to access a single legitimate subscription card remotely. A “CCCam line” contains server details, a port, a username, and a password. When entered into a receiver or softcam, it decrypts channels as if the user had the original card.
